Helen of Troy is a global consumer products company with a portfolio of brands in Home & Outdoor and Beauty & Wellness. It sells everyday consumer goods built on more than 55 years of experience, focusing on quality and reliability. The company differentiates itself through a broad, world-class brand lineup, long-standing expertise, and a culture that emphasizes employee growth and teamwork. Its goal is to grow its brands and deliver dependable products to consumers while supporting personal and collective success within its organization.

Helen of Troy Amends Credit Agreement

Helen of Troy Ltd has amended its credit agreement, as per an SEC filing. The company's revolving credit facility has been reduced to $750 million.

Helen of Troy Acquires Olive & June for $240M

Helen of Troy announced a definitive merger agreement to acquire Olive & June for $240 million. The deal includes $225 million in cash at closing and a $15 million earnout over three years. Olive & June, a nail care brand, will operate as a stand-alone entity within Helen of Troy. The acquisition aligns with Helen of Troy's strategic goals and is expected to enhance revenue growth and gross profit margin. Olive & June's 2024 net sales are projected to be approximately $92 million.
